Answer:Dopamine
Explanation:Dopamine is a neurotransmitter which functions as a transmitter that transfer signals in the brain. Neurotransmitters are natural chemicals found in our body produced by our nerve cells called neurons. We use neurotransmitters to communicate messages throughout various parts of our brain and between the brain up to the whole body.Dopamine is crucial for controlling our movement.
The brain contains several distinct dopamine pathways, which are crucial and play a great role in how we get motivated by rewards. As we wait eagerly for the rewards dopamine increases in our brain. The drugs also increases the levels of dopamine.
